SINGLE FAMILY HOMES

This classic Home Style is a freestanding building that is separate from the neighbouring homes. The variations within this style often relate to the placement of the garage. For example, a front attached garage provides a convenient all-seasons entrance to the house from within the garage. Alternatively, rear lane homes may be more visually appealing from the front because the garage is located separately at the back.

Here are some examples of different types of Single Family homes:

Single Family Front Attached Garage
This is one of the most popular choices, with the garage located at the front.

Single Family Rear Lane
These homes have a detached garage located at the back, accessible by an alley or laneway.

DUPLEX

Featuring two distinct living spaces within a single structure, each home includes a basement, an open-concept main floor, and bedrooms upstairs. They are a great choice for families seeking a home with a more affordable price tag.

Duplex Front Attached Garage
In this type of Duplex, both garages are located at the front.

Duplex Rear Lane
In this type of Duplex, both garages are located at the back, accessible by an alley or laneway.

TOWNHOMES

Townhomes have multiple units built together in a row, with each townhome sharing at least one wall with the neighbouring units. Townhomes typically have multiple stories with the living space on one level and the bedrooms above. They are popular with young families looking for their first home as well as retired couples who want to downsize.

Townhome Front Attached Garage
An attached garage is located at the front of the Townhome.

Townhome Rear Lane
A detached garage is located at the back with rear lane access.

EXECUTIVE

These homes are built on wider lots, which increases their overall square footage. Executive homes have greater options for customization, premium fixtures, and high-end finishes. They can also accommodate a three-car garage, if desired.

Split Duplex
In this configuration, one of the homes in the Duplex has a front attached garage while the other has a rear detached garage with lane access.
